Unlocking the Power of MLS in Real Estate

Moving on from real estate old school marketing practices, we’re now well beyond the time when we had to browse old MLS books to find our ideal homes. Today, property listing is mostly done online as it’s much more convenient. However, as a real estate agent or an owner who wants to sell their property by themselves, you should know how to properly create an online listing.

The Multiple Listing Service (MLS) emerges as an essential tool, bridging the gap between property seekers and sellers by providing a centralized database of listings. But working through the vast online real estate market can be overwhelming for both buyers and sellers.

For buyers, MLS offers an extensive selection of homes to browse through, while sellers and agents make use of it by maximizing their property's visibility. Understanding how to effectively use MLS platforms is essential for standing out in a competitive market.

Essential Guidelines for MLS Listings

Creating a successful MLS listing involves adhering to specific guidelines to ensure your property stands out without violating platform rules. High-quality photos are paramount, serving as the first impression for potential buyers. Including images from every room and a clear exterior shot can significantly enhance your listing's appeal. Also, transparency is crucial, if for example, virtual staging is used, it should be clearly labeled to maintain trust with viewers.

Crafting Compelling Property Features

Beyond photos, accurately detailing property features is vital for attracting serious inquiries. So, knowing how to write effective property descriptions is an absolute must. Listings should include essential information such as square footage, number of rooms, and available amenities.

For example, specifying a recently renovated kitchen or a spacious backyard can make your property more attractive. However, it's equally important to avoid exaggerations or irrelevant details that could mislead potential buyers or lead to legal issues.

Mastering Property Descriptions

A well-written property description can make a significant difference in capturing a buyer's interest. Keeping descriptions concise, ideally under 250 words, while highlighting key features and unique selling points is recommended.

For instance, emphasizing a property's excellent layout or its proximity to local schools can resonate well with buyers. Avoiding technical jargon and maintaining honesty ensures that your listing remains credible and appealing.

Understanding Different MLS Types

MLS platforms come in various forms, each catering to different needs based on ownership, geographical scope, and property types. Association-owned MLSs are managed by real estate associations and require membership fees, while broker-owned MLSs are controlled by individual brokers who set their own listing rules.

Additionally, MLSs can be local, national, or specialized based on the types of properties they feature, such as residential, commercial, or rental listings. Understanding these distinctions helps agents choose the right platform for their specific needs.
